| Thomas I. Vogel; Dept. of Mathematics, Texas A&M University | |
| In learning calculus, students develop intuitive ideas of such concepts as limit, continuity, differentiability, and so on, useful in dealing with simple examples, but potentially a hindrance to deeper understanding of the basic concepts of mathematical analysis. Vogel's gallery challenges and refines the intuition of better calculus students and students in advanced calculus. Three semesters of calculus are covered. | |
